Talk on Continuous Control Monitoring

21/06/2018 | Completed Event

The World Trade Center Kochi in association with the Confederation of Indian Industry organized a talk on “Continuous Control Monitoring” on 21 st June 2018 at CII office. Mr Johar Batterywala, Partner & Mr David George, Sr. Manager-Deloitte India were the speakers. Continuous Control Monitoring refers to use of technologies and analytics to continuously monitor the financial transactions or internal controls which in turns provides actionable insights to the management. Mr Johar Batterywala gave an overview of the subject & also touched upon the challenges faced by companies and their employees during the audit process. Mr David George talked about the role of BOTs and how Robotic Process Automation (RPA) is applied for the processing of documents. The session was an opportunity for the participants to clarify the concerns with the subject experts. CCM is expected to improve the efficiency and effectiveness of the audit process and most importantly will save time. A demo of the CCM Dash Board was also performed for a better understanding of the subject. The session was attended by participants representing various industries like - Exporters, Financial Institutions, Manufacturing and Processing industries, IT, Finance Consultants, Builders, Automobile Dealers etc.
